Understanding Android Flip Phone Touch Screen Technology
Modern Android flip phones are very different from the traditional flip phones that were popular in the early 2000s. Older models relied on physical keypads and small displays, while today’s devices feature large foldable touchscreens powered by the Android operating system.
The biggest innovation is the flexible OLED display. Manufacturers have developed screens that can bend repeatedly without damaging the display. This allows users to fold the device in half while maintaining a premium smartphone experience.
When closed, many Android flip phones display notifications, widgets, weather updates, and messages on a smaller external screen. When opened, the device reveals a large touchscreen that functions just like a traditional smartphone.
The engineering behind these devices involves advanced hinges, ultra-thin glass, flexible display layers, and sophisticated software optimization. These technologies work together to create a seamless folding experience.

Popular Android Flip Phone Touch Screen Models
Among the most recognized devices is the Samsung Galaxy Z Flip series. Samsung has played a major role in popularizing foldable smartphones by refining hinge technology, improving durability, and enhancing software experiences.
The Galaxy Z Flip lineup offers premium displays, powerful processors, impressive cameras, and excellent software integration. Many users consider it one of the most polished foldable smartphone experiences available today.
Another strong competitor is the Motorola Razr series. Inspired by the iconic Razr phones of the past, modern Motorola foldables combine nostalgia with cutting-edge technology. The company has focused on creating sleek designs and improving the foldable experience with each generation.
Other manufacturers have also entered the foldable smartphone market. Competition continues to drive innovation, resulting in better displays, stronger hinges, and improved affordability for consumers.
Android Flip Phone Touch Screen vs Traditional Smartphones
Traditional smartphones offer a familiar experience, but Android flip phones provide several unique advantages.
Portability is one of the most noticeable differences. A foldable phone can fit comfortably into smaller pockets while still providing a large display when opened.
Flexibility is another advantage. Traditional smartphones require external stands or accessories for hands-free viewing, whereas foldable devices can often stand independently.
However, conventional smartphones may still offer advantages in terms of lower costs and slightly simpler construction. Since foldable technology is relatively new, premium flip phones often carry higher price tags.
Durability has improved dramatically, but traditional smartphones generally have fewer moving parts. That said, modern foldable devices undergo extensive testing to ensure long-term reliability.
Ultimately, the choice depends on personal preferences. Users seeking innovation and portability may prefer a flip phone, while those prioritizing affordability might choose a traditional smartphone.
